This Little Free Library is located at Smokin D's BBQ at the intersection of U.S. Highway 1 and State Road 206 in St. Augustine, Florida, USA.

This Little Free Library is a dark red painted wood box that has been distressed to look old. It has a wooden roof that has white metal sheeting on top. A small see-through door on the front of the box is trimmed in the same distressed dark red painted wood and has a silver metal handle, latch, and hinges. The box rests atop a wooden post. Above the window on the door is a white sign with the website for LittleFreeLibrary.org and the invitation to "Take a Book * Return a Book" in black lettering.
There is a Rotary International plaque on the lower left corner of he door. A small plaque below the door reads: "Sponsored by St. Augustine Sunrise Rotary, Students in the Building Construction program at Pedro Menendez High School, and Smokin D's BBQ." On the LittleFreeLibrary map for this library is the following information: "St. Augustine Sunrise Rotary has long partnered with Learn to Read of St. Johns County, Inc. at our annual fundraiser, The Rhythm & Ribs Festival. This year one of the projects we decided to take on was the installation of ten Little Free Libraries. We also partnered with the Architectural and Building Career Academy at Pedro Menendez High School to build the libraries."
